What are the most common 2020-2025 GMC Sierra HD problems?

The 2020-2025 GMC Sierra HD has accumulated 442 NHTSA complaints. The most frequently reported problem areas are Transmission, Electrical System, Brakes. As with any used vehicle, a pre-purchase inspection and vehicle history report are recommended.

What should I check before buying a used GMC Sierra HD?

Before buying a used GMC Sierra HD, verify all open recalls are completed via the NHTSA VIN lookup tool. Pay particular attention to Transmission, Electrical System, Brakes, which are the most commonly reported problem areas. Request maintenance records, have an independent mechanic inspect the vehicle, and run a vehicle history report to check for prior accidents or title issues.
